The first question can be answered looking at the steps of the sequencing and choosing from there. I will choose two that I like and explain briefly:
1) Ligation of adapters: Once the DNA is fragmented in shorter parts (200-600 base pairs), short sequencies of DNA called adaptors are attached to this fragments in order to allow them to bind to a flow cell and also be amplified by PCR.
2)Adding bases: The first sequencing cycle begins by adding four labeled reversible terminators, primers, and DNA polymerase. Each of the terminator bases (A, C, G and T) give off a different colour.
